Transaction 20aa5868f7143104a9b8d3b530cbc41e265ad0c715be401e6aa2f67f8578bb92

4 Input
1 Outputs
  • 20aa5868f7143104a9b8d3b530cbc41e265ad0c715be401e6aa2f67f8578bb92:0
  • value  2851071
    address  1FdsEkenS1168CEXn99NA2FDsVihmW24UT